Computer-on-Module (COM) [ROM-7720]

NXP i.MX8 QuadMax Qseven 2.1 Computer-on-Module

RROM-7720 is a standard Qseven 2.1 computer-on-module equipped with the next-generation ARM processor NXP i.MX8 QuadMax. The ROM-7720 has become the most powerful and reliable ARM module solution ever, featuring 8 processor cores, a frequency of up to 1.6 GHz, an independent MCU processing unit, and two highly integrated graphic processing units. Specifications and Features: - NXP i.MX8 QuadMax 8-core processor with 2 Cortex-A72, 4 Cortex-A53, and 2 Cortex-M4F - Multi-OS support for Ubuntu / Debian / Yocto Linux, Android - 64-bit LPDDR4 2GB / 4GB - 4K H.265 decoder, HD H.264 encoder - Onboard QSPI flash 256MB, eMMC flash 8GB, boot selection from SPI / eMMC / SD or S-ATA - 3 USB 3.0 with OTG, dual-lane MIPI camera

SOM-5885 equipped with 14th generation Intel Core Ultra

Computer-on-module equipped with 14th generation Intel Core Ultra processor *Mass production samples now available.

The "SOM-5885" is a computer-on-module that conforms to the COM Express Basic standard. It is equipped with the 14th generation Intel Core Ultra processor (Code Name: Meteor Lake-U/H), which offers a 24% improvement in CPU processing performance compared to the 13th generation, and a 90% increase in image processing performance thanks to the latest Xe LPG graphics. Additionally, it features Intel's first AI engine, the NPU (Neural Processing Unit), which not only enhances AI computation speed but also achieves power efficiency and energy savings, reducing reliance on external graphics cards. Furthermore, it supports high-speed I/O such as PCI Express Gen4, 2.5G LAN, and USB 4.0. COM module "Qseven" [Q7-BT]

Intel Atom processor equipped standard size Qseven module

The concept of Qseven is an off-the-shelf, multi-vendor computer-on-module that integrates all core components of a typical PC and is implemented on application-oriented carrier boards. Qseven modules come in standard form factors of 70 mm x 70 mm or 40 mm x 70 mm, featuring specific pinouts compatible with high-speed MXM connectors, allowing use with products from any vendor. Qseven modules provide features such as graphics, audio, large-capacity storage, networking, and multiple USB ports for embedded applications. A robust 230-pin MXM connector provides a carrier board interface that can transmit and receive all I/O signals with the Qseven module. This MXM connector is a well-known, proven high-speed signal interface connector widely used in laptop PCI Express graphics cards.

Computer on Module (COM) VCOM-1600

COM Express Type 6 compatible computer-on-module (COM) VCOM-1600

The "VCOM-1600," a computer-on-module (COM) equipped with the Intel Atom x6000E processor (Elkhart Lake) and compliant with COM Express Type 6, features a compact form factor (95mm x 95mm) and supports real-time data synchronization with Intel TSN/TCC standards. It enables 4K display output through various interfaces such as DDI, VGA, and LVDS.
